❓WHAT IS A PASTA MAKER
A pasta maker is a specialized kitchen appliance designed to transform fresh dough into various pasta shapes. Modern pasta makers come in both electric and manual versions, offering different levels of automation and versatility. These devices typically feature interchangeable dies or molds for creating different pasta styles, from traditional spaghetti to wide fettuccine.

Things To Consider When Choosing a Pasta Maker
- Power Source: Consider whether a manual, electric, or rechargeable model best suits your needs and kitchen setup
- Capacity: Evaluate the machine's output capacity relative to your typical serving needs
- Build Quality: Look for durable materials like stainless steel or high-grade ABS that ensure longevity
- Versatility: Check the number and types of pasta shapes available through included dies or molds
- Ease of Cleaning: Consider machines with detachable parts and dishwasher-safe components for easier maintenance
- Storage Space: Factor in the machine's size and storage requirements in your kitchen
